EB Captives Evolve Beyond Financing Into Strategic Risk Management Platforms
Employee benefits captives have transformed from simple financing mechanisms into strategic platforms that deliver long-term financial value and support broader corporate objectives, according to International SOS Chief Risk Officer Franck Baron. Baron’s company has used its employee benefits (EB) captive to retain underwriting results, smooth volatility, and improve predictability across cycles while expanding into health risk management initiatives. Airmic: Reevaluating People Risk Management A Necessity
Airmic’s report, Managing Risk−The Human Factor, sheds light on the “unprecedented volatility with regards to people risk” and stresses the importance of HR, benefits, and risk professionals working together more closely. The report published in December 2019 in association with Arthur D. Little, Willis Towers Watson and Zurich, positions people risk around the people themselves instead of creating newer categories.
